Quick Facts — Washington Heights CDP

What is the median household income in Washington Heights CDP?
The median household income in Washington Heights CDP is $78,663 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in Washington Heights CDP?
The poverty rate in Washington Heights CDP is 12.7%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in Washington Heights CDP?
$365,400 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in Washington Heights CDP?
The median gross rent in Washington Heights CDP is $2,222 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of Washington Heights CDP residents have a college degree?
27.8% of adults in Washington Heights CDP h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
